The Asthma Score in 98336, Glenoma, Washington is 15 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

87.88 percent of the population in 98336 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 84.85 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 0.00 percent of the residents in 98336 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.70 members with about 2.38 cars available per household.

An estimate of 92.06 percent of the residents in 98336 has some form of health insurance. 58.73 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 80.95 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 98336 would have to travel an average of 7.53 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Arbor Health Morton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 98336, Glenoma, Washington.

As of , an estimate of 693 residents live in 98336 with a median age of 39.0 years. 27.99 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 29.87 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 30.69 percent of the residents in 98336 is currently married, and 9.07 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 98336 is $5,890.17.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 98336 is approximately $1,031. The median household spends about 17.50 percent of their income on housing.

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ition characterized by inflammation and narrowing of the airways, leading to symptoms such as wheezing, shortness of breath, coughing, and chest tightness. Access to healthcare services is vital for individuals with Asthma to manage their condition effectively and prevent exacerbations that may require emergency care.
